[quote=Anonymous][quote=Anonymous][quote=Anonymous][quote=Anonymous]How common is a full ride to an Ivy law school? I have heard that with a certain gpa and lsat that it is a possibility. Is this true?[/quote] Common? About as common as flying monkeys. As with undergraduate the Ivies focus on need based aid, not merit. They also consider parent income/assets for applicants below certain age limits, i.e. for HLS unless over 29. [/quote] 2% of Cornell has a full tuition scholarship. 26% have half to full tuition scholarships. 2 Columbia students have scholarships exceeding full tuition. 5% have full tuition scholarships. 13% have half to full tuition. 1% of Penn students have scholarships exceeding full tuition. 13% have full tuition scholarships. 21% have half to full tuition.
